How quickly can Yukon businesses get funded through online lenders?
Some fintech and alternative lenders can approve and disburse funds in 24 to 72 hours. They rely on automated underwriting, bank statement analysis, and digital integrations to bypass traditional delays.

What are realistic interest rates for Yukon business loans?
Rates depend on risk, term, security, and product. Traditional term loans might be priced between 5% and 15%, while online or alternative loans could carry effective rates higher (especially for shorter or unsecured products).

What business age and revenue must Yukon companies have to qualify?
Many online lenders require businesses to have operated for 6 to 12 months with consistent revenue (often $50,000+ annually).
Newer or lower-revenue businesses might use MCAs or factoring instead of term loans until they scale.
How does geography or remoteness in Yukon affect lender decisions?
Remote Yukon locations add logistics and risk, which may lead lenders to:
-
Require stronger proofs (contracts, recurring clients)
-
Ask for higher down payments or reserves
-
Discount value of physical collateral
To overcome this, present service contracts, regional guarantees, or steady client pipelines.

How does invoice factoring help Yukon businesses?
Factoring lets you sell invoices for immediate cash without increasing debt. It's ideal when you have B2B clients and delayed payments.

What documentation should Yukon businesses prepare for fast approval?
Prepare:
-
Recent financial statements
-
Bank statements (3-12 months)
-
List of contracts or recurring clients
-
Ownership and registration documents
-
Sales history or POS data
Online lenders may accept fewer documents but rely heavily on transaction data and cash flow.
What collateral do Yukon lenders require for fast loans?
For fast unsecured financing, you might need minimal traditional collateral. But many lenders still require:
-
Personal guarantees
-
Equipment, inventory, AR
-
Real estate in some cases
Collateral demands vary; online lenders tend to accept lighter or digital assets in exchange for higher pricing.

How do Yukon economic factors and grants influence my funding options?
Yukon businesses benefit from territorial programs and northern funding initiatives. For example, the Yukon government's Trade Resilience Program provides grants to businesses adapting to trade shifts.
You may combine grants or government support with loans to lower net cost.
What fees or hidden costs should I watch out for?
Watch for:
-
Origination or processing fees
-
Hidden daily or transaction fees
-
Prepayment or exit fees
-
Aggressive factor rates disguised as "flat fees"

What loan sizes are available from online lenders in Yukon?
Many fintech lenders offer $5,000 to $500,000+, depending on revenue and history. For very large capital needs, traditional lenders or government-backed programs might be more appropriate.
How do credit and business metrics factor versus Yukon location?
Some lenders will discount your location if you're remote. But strong metrics (low debt ratio, consistent cash flow, good margins) can override geographic penalties.
